Dish from the Hoi An Wreck, late 15e century
The Hoi An wreck was found byfishermen early 1990. Excavation began in 1996 and took 4 years.
The dish is of typical Vietnamese porcelain. Decorated in cobalt blue underglaze from the Hanoi Delta region kilns. The bottom is finished in a chocolat colour, characteristic for Vietnamese porcelain
